Abstract

The bottle stopper has two parts. The inner part (4) screws on to the bottle neck and has a flat top. The second part forms a sleeve over the inner part. It is kept in position by a ring (3) caught under the ring (16) on the bottle. The top of the outer sleeve has a starred opening (8) and an easily gripped surface (6) on the outside. The outer sleeve is loose over the cap (4) unless pressed down over it to deform the star (8), when the two parts are locked together for opening.
